The loss of the natural grasslands in the Free State, Northern Province, Mpumalanga and KwaZulu-Natal, and the replacement of the natural vegetation with wheat and dryland pastures in the wheat producing regions of the Swartland and Overberg in the Western Cape, changed the distribution and demographics of the Blue Crane population. Historically, Blue Cranes occurred mainly in the grassland biome along the eastern section of the country.

The first is in the Overberg/Swartland regions of the Western Cape Province, the second is the central Karoo population (the southeastern region of the Northern Cape province and the western regions of the Eastern Cape province extending into the southern regions of the Free State), while the third is situated along the eastern section of the country and includes the southern parts of Mpumalanga, the northeastern Free State and parts of KwaZulu-Natal. Within South Africa there are three main Blue Crane strongholds. That means it’s abundant in limited areas of its range, but is rare in most areas of South Africa. It is the most range restricted of all the cranes in the world. The Blue Crane is a near-endemic to South Africa with a small isolated population of about 60-80 birds found around the Etosha Pans in Namibia and a few isolated birds in Botswana and Swaziland.
